Stock analysts aren’t the only ones calling the residential-solar model into question. Late last year, Forbes said an industry whistleblower had reported to the IRS that swollen tax-credit says was common across the residential-solar space. In August, the Stanford professor David F. Larcker and Brian Tayan, a corporate-governance researcher at the school, published an alarming analysis titled “Solar Flare Up: Systemic Organizational Risk in the Residential Solar Industry.” The authors said a cocktail of convoluted financing, tax credits, high sales commissions, and uncertain costs “have combined to create an incredibly complex industry with multiple points of potential breakdown.” They cited the recent bankruptcies of the solar giants Titan Solar, iSun, SunPower, and various others “due to financial distress, changes in regulatory standards, or fraud” as harbingers for a wider collapse.
